- Storm report NWS AKQ storm report
TSTM WND DMG — 2 S Locust Creek, VA
A large tree about 4 feet wide at the base and 20 to 30 feet tall fell into a single family home on Dusty Rd in Louisa County. No injuries reported.
- Storm report NWS AKQ storm report
TSTM WND DMG — Orchid, VA
Numerous trees down over southeastern Louisa county south and east of Apple Grove.
- Storm report NWS AKQ storm report
TSTM WND DMG — 2 SSW Hadensville, VA
Trees down blocking Route 606.
- Storm report NWS AKQ storm report
TSTM WND DMG — Clinton, VA
Trees and powerlines down on Pinegrove Road near US-60. Time estimated from radar.
- Storm report NWS AKQ storm report
TSTM WND DMG — 2 NNE Sunnyside, VA
Trees down on a vehicle on Loggers Way. Trees and power lines down along Almond Lane and Frenchs Store Road. Time estimated from radar.
